Linux内核深度调优:Shell终端掌控服务器运维巅峰

Linux内核是操作系统的核心,它负责管理硬件资源、进程调度以及内存分配等关键任务。对Linux内核进行深度调优,能够显著提升服务器的性能和稳定性。

Shell终端作为与Linux系统交互的主要工具,掌握其高级用法对于服务器运维至关重要。通过编写高效的Shell脚本,可以自动化日常任务,减少人为错误并提高工作效率。

在调优过程中,了解内核参数的作用是基础。例如,调整sysctl配置文件中的net.ipv4.tcp_tw_reuse和net.core.somaxconn等参数,有助于优化网络连接处理能力。

日志分析也是调优的重要环节。使用grep、awk等命令结合日志文件,可以快速定位系统瓶颈,如频繁的I/O操作或内存泄漏问题。

AI绘图结果,仅供参考

硬件层面的调优同样不可忽视。合理配置CPU频率、调整磁盘IO调度器,以及优化文件系统参数,都能有效提升服务器的整体性能。

持续监控和测试是确保调优效果的关键。利用top、htop、iostat等工具实时观察系统状态,结合压力测试验证调优后的表现。

综合运用内核调优与Shell脚本技术,能够实现对服务器的精细化管理,达到运维效率与系统性能的双重提升。

dawei

【声明】:安庆站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。